Directions:

  1. Preheat oven to 350-degrees F.
  2. Spray 9-inch pie plate with Pam. (I use a corning ware quiche dish).
  3. Heat oil in skillet over med. high heat. Add onion and saute until browned (5 min).
  4. Add spinach; cook until excess moisture evaporates. Let cool.
  5. Beat eggs in bowl. Add cheese.
  6. Stir egg-cheese mixture into onion-spinach mixture. Season to taste with salt and pepper, if desired.
  7. Turn into pie pan, spreading top evenly.
  8. Bake until top is browned and tester (I use a toothpick) comes out clean, 40-45 minutes.
